    Notes: Abstract This study compared the effects of the β-carboline anxiolytic, abecarnil, with other benzodiazepine receptor (BZR) ligands, including the full agonists diazepam and alprazolam, and the partial agonists ZK 95962 and bretazenil (Ro 16-6028), and alpidem, in the mouse four-plate test and plus-maze. The efficacy and potency of each compound was related to the fraction of BZR occupied by the drug. Abecarnil was efficacious in both tests and showed anxiolytic effects comparable with alprazolam and diazepam. In the four-plate test, abecarnil, bretazenil, and ZK 95962 had selective effects on releasing exploratory locomotor activity suppressed by footshock (punished crossings). None of these compounds significantly altered non-punished crossings. In contrast, diazepam and alprazolam increased both unpunished and punished crossings at low to medium doses (receptor occupancies of approximately 20–60%). The number of punished and unpunished crossings fell to control levels or below at higher, more sedative doses (approximately 80% receptor occupancy). Alpidem had very weak anxiolytic-like effects in this test and markedly reduced unpunished crossings at relatively low receptor occupancies (〉 15%). In the plus-maze, abecarnil increased the time spent in the open arms and the percentage open arm entries to an extent equal to that observed following diazepam or alprazolam administration. Bretazenil and ZK 95962 had weak effects on the measures of anxiolytic activity in this test. Alpidem also had little anxiolytic-like activity in the plus-maze but markedly reduced the total number of arm entries. The fractional BZR occupancies required to increase the time spent in the open arms of the maze to 250% of control levels were approximately 45% for abecarnil and alprazolam, 60% for diazepam, and 100% for ZK 95962. Bretazenil did not reach this potentiation at the doses tested (up to 89% receptor occupancy). Abecarnil appeared to act as a full agonist on the measures of anxiolytic activity in both tests (i.e. required low fractional BZR occupancies) but on the measures of stimulation or sedation was more similar to the BZR partial agonists (i.e. had no significant effects even at receptor occupancies approaching 100%). On this basis abecarnil could be described as a “selective agonist”. In general, the four-plate test was more sensitive than the plus-maze. For example, lower BZR occupancies were needed to produce significant anxiolytic effects in the four-plate test than in the plus-maze. In addition, the partial agonists bretazenil and ZK 95962, which both produced weak effects in the plus-maze, had similar anxiolytic potencies to the full BZR agonists, diazepam and alprazolam, in the four-plate test.

    Notes: Abstract We studied 20 electrophoretic loci in two populations ofAteles (Ateles paniscus paniscus andAteles paniscus chamek). We observed intrapopulational variation at the following loci: esterase D, glyoxalase 1, adenosine deaminase (A. p. chamek) and carbonic anhydrase 2 (A. p. paniscus). The two populations share the most frequent alleles at 17 loci, but we noted great differences in glyoxalase 1, adenosine deaminase and phosphoglucomutase 1.A. p. paniscus is monomorphic for theGLO1 *1 allele, which has a frequency of 6% inA. p.chamek. They did not share alleles in relation to the ADA and PGM1 loci. We found a CA2 allele, named hereCA2 *1, which has not been described previously in other neotropical primates (Sampaio et al., 1991a), inA. p. paniscus. The present results suggest that the geographical isolation represented by the Rio Amazonas has lasted long enough to support this level of divergence. These observations taken together with chromosomal findings, led us to endorse the proposal of two distinct species:Ateles paniscus andAteles chamek.

    Notes: Abstract A wild population situated in the border of the distributions ofSaimiri sciureus macrodon andS. boliviensis peruviensis, in the Peruvian Amazonia, was studied in relation to 22 protein loci. These genetic markers provided indications of secondary intergradation between these two taxa, reinforcing previous morphological and cytogenetic evidences. Continued studies in this region on the hybrids' viability and fertility may be important for decisions related to the taxonomy of this genus.

    Notes: Abstract A comparative study of 20 blood genetic systems was performed on three populations of genusSaguinus: S. fuscicollis weddelli, S. midas niger, andS. midas midas. Some markers are useful for the characterization of the two species.ADA 5, ADA6, CA23, CA24, andES2 2 occur only inS. fuscicollis whileADA 4is fixed inS. midas. S. midas midas showed heterozygosity value comparable to those previously obtained for the genusAlouatta. Estimates of genetic distance betweenS. fuscicollis andS. midas species of about 14% are in accordance with those referred to in the literature for interspecific differences. Genetic distances between subspecies ofSaguinus midas were nearly 3%, which is within the range for subspecies.

    Notes: Abstract The electrophoretic patterns of 15 protein systems codified for 20 genetic loci were investigated using horizontal electrophoresis. A total of 150 blood samples, from five species of the genusCallithrix were analyzed. Polymorphic variation was observed in 10 out 20 loci analyzed. The genotypic distributions are in Hardy-Weinberg equilibrium. The average heterozygosity (H) varied from 1% to 5%, similar to those observed for other Neotropical primates. The genetic distance coefficients revealed a phylogenetic separation of these species into two groups: (1) “argentata” (C. humeralifer andC. emiliae); (2) “jacchus” (C. jacchus, C. penicillata, andC. geoffroyi). This arrangement is according to the taxonomic arrangement proposed byHershkovitz (1977),de Vivo (1988), andMittermeier et al. (1988). The results in each group are compatible with the subspecies values recorded for the Platyrrhini. These values showed that:C. humeralifer andC. emiliae are subspecies ofC. argentata;C. jacchus, C. penicillata, andC. geoffroyi are subspecies ofC. jacchus. These results also suggest thatC. j. geoffroyi is the “jacchus” group taxon, most similar genetically to the “argentata” group.

    Notes: Abstract Implementations of artificial neural networks as analog VLSI circuits differ in their method of synaptic weight storage (digital weights, analog EEPROMs, or capacitive weights) and in whether learning is performed locally at the synapses or off-chip. In this paper, we explain the principles of analog networks with in situ or local synaptic learning of capacitive weights, with test results of CMOS implementations from our laboratory. Synapses for both simple Hebbian and mean field networks are investigated. Synaptic weights may be refreshed by periodic rehearsal on the training data, which compensates for temperature drift or other nonstationarity. Compact high-performance layouts have been obtained in which learning adjusts for component variability.

    Notes: Abstract In combination with the biofragmentable Valtrac ring a newly developed purse-string suture clamp offers the possibility of performing intraperitoneal anastomoses of the small and large bowel without the need for stapling devices. During this experimental study endto-end anastomoses of the descending colon were constructed in five pigs. One animal was re-examined on day 1 after the operation and the others were all sacrificed on day 21 after. None of the animals showed any signs of an anastomotic leakage. Little scar tissue was seen macroscopically or histologically in the anastomotic region of the animals sacrificed 3 weeks after the operation. The operative technique presented in this paper might render the so-called assisted laparoscopic procedures for the right hemicolon unnecessary in the future.

    Notes: Synthesis and Properties of Macrocycles from Resorcinol, Corresponding Derivatives and Host-Guest ComplexesStructural variations of the metacyclophanes obtained from the condensation of resorcinol with aldehydes RCHO are described, mostly based on the stereoisomer with all R in cis configuration. The basic tetraphenolate (with R = CH3, 1a) shows a cone-conformation as evident e.g. from vicinal 13C-C-C-1H coupling constants. Substituents R′ in the 2-position of the phenyl rings at the upper rim of the macro-cycle are either introduced with the resorcinol derivative used (R′ = CH3, COOH), or by Mannich reactions after cyclization (R′ = CH2NR″2), which partially lead to intermediate oxacine formation. Acid-base properties are evaluated with potentiometric and NMR-shift titrations. Mannich products from amino acids such as proline, which are formed without racemization, show no pK differences for the groups at the four equivalent phenyl rings, but three distinct pK values for the deprotonation of OH, COOH, and +NH3 substituents; the pK of the latter is two units lower than in proline itself as it is involved in hydrogen bridging. Complexation constants K of such derivatives with Fe3+, Cu2+, and Zn2+ show the expected increase with metal ion acidity; they are increased by a power of 5 in comparison to proline. Complexation constants and complexation-induced NMR shifts (CIS values) are determined for 51 complexes, with positively charged organic guest molecules for the basic tetraphenolate skeleton as well as for the aminomethylation derivatives. A temperature dependence study shows that the corresponding equilibrium is driven by ΔH with negligible ΔS contributions. No chiral discrimation is observed upon complexation of e.g. carnitine with the optically active amino acid derivatives. This is in line with CIS and K values obtained with several complexes showing an orientation of the NR″2 groups away from the cavity. The COOH substituents R′ form strong hydrogen bonds with the adjacent phenolic groups, leading to alternating pseudo-eq and -ax positions of the phenyl rings. Their interconversion barrier, determined by NMR spectroscopy, is 72 kJ mol-1; they bind mono- and bis-ammonium ions as function of distance matching. The presence of lipophilic substituents (R = phenyl, benzyl, biphenyl, n-hexyl, n-undecyl) at the bottom of the macrocycle furnishes a second binding center which allows to complex e.g. diethyl ether in water. Coordination of zinc to the proline derivative still allows co-complexation of choline acetate, the hydrolysis of which is not inhibited anymore as it is by the zinc-free macrocycle.

    Notes: Abstract Conformations, acid-base and supramolecular properties of phenolic metacyclophanes obtained from the condensation of resorcinol with aldehydes are discussed, including the mechanisms involved in the formation of these macrocycles. The strong binding of choline-type compounds and the inhibition of acetylcholine hydrolysis with therccc stereoisomers is mechanistically evaluated; arctt isomer shows strong conformational coupling for, e.g., choline binding and simultaneous proton release. The presence of larger alkyl residues at the bottom of therccc macrocycle leads to an additional binding site for small lipophilic substrates, which is independent of the upper complexation center for positively charged substrates. Substitution at the upper rim by carboxylic groups at the 2-position of the phenyl rings yields receptors for, e.g., α, ω-diammonium ions with alternate equatorial and axial arylunits. Positively charged substituents at the upper rim, introduced by aminoalkylation, lead to little change of complexation as a result from their orientation away from the binding center. Aminoacid substituents, for the same reason, do not lead to enantioselective complexation, but allow particularly for strong binding of transition metal ions. Preliminary studies show that resorcinarenes bearing a wide array of positive charges are potent groove binders to ds-DNA without intercalative contributions.
